What type of battery is in the 2016 Mercedes-Benz G‑Class?
- The 2016 Mercedes-Benz G‑Class is best served by a factory-specified 12‑volt battery designed for high electrical loads; Mercedes-Benz often specifies AGM (Absorbent Glass Mat) or equivalent high-performance batteries for modern luxury vehicles.
- AGM batteries offer better vibration resistance, faster recharge, and improved performance under heavy accessory loads compared to conventional lead-acid units.

2016 Mercedes-Benz G‑Class Battery Type
The recommended battery type for a 2016 Mercedes-Benz G‑Class is one that meets Mercedes-Benz electrical specifications—typically a high-quality 12‑volt battery engineered for luxury applications. In many cases, AGM (Absorbent Glass Mat) units are specified because they handle higher electrical loads, offer improved vibration resistance, and recharge more efficiently than conventional flooded batteries. Choosing the correct battery chemistry is essential: an incorrect type can lead to charging inefficiencies, shortened battery life, or system incompatibilities. 2016 Mercedes-Benz G‑Class Battery Size
Battery size for a 2016 Mercedes-Benz G‑Class involves both physical dimensions and electrical capacity (cold-cranking amps and reserve capacity). Correct physical fit is critical to avoid loose mounting and vibration-related damage; proper electrical capacity ensures reliable starts and stable voltage for electronics.
